Google Doodle Pays Tribute Nigerian Football Legend, Rashidi Yekini

Google has honoured the late Nigerian footballer Rashidi Yekini with a doodle on what would have been his 60th birthday

 In a touching homage to one of Nigeria’s football legends, Google has created a captivating doodle that resurrects the iconic moment when Rashidi Yekini celebrated his historic goal during the 1994 World Cup. Yekini, who overcame poverty and homelessness, is remembered as one of Nigeria’s greatest football stars, and this artwork honors his unforgettable contribution to the sport.

The Google doodle encapsulates the essence of Yekini’s celebration when, following his goal against Bulgaria, he raced to the net, gripping it with both arms while tears of joy streamed down his face. This iconic gesture marked Nigeria’s first-ever World Cup finals goal and remains etched in football history.

“Many consider it one of the most iconic goal celebrations in football history, and it served as inspiration for today’s Doodle artwork,” stated Google.

During the 1994 World Cup, Nigeria triumphed over Bulgaria with a resounding 3-0 victory, marking a significant moment in the nation’s football history. Although the team was later eliminated by Italy in the Round of 16, Yekini’s legacy continued to shine.

Yekini holds the record for the most goals scored in the history of the Super Eagles, with an impressive tally of 37 goals. His impact extended beyond the international stage, as he enjoyed a prolific club career. He achieved significant success with notable clubs, including Shooting Stars of Nigeria, Ivory Coast’s Africa Sport, and Vitoria Setubal of Portugal, among others.

In 1984, Yekini played a pivotal role in leading Shooting Stars to the final of the African Champions Cup, a precursor to today’s African Champions League. It was also in that same year that he made his debut for the Nigerian national team.

Rashidi Yekini’s prowess on the field culminated in him being named the African Footballer of the Year in 1993, solidifying his status as one of the continent’s football greats. He was affectionately referred to as the “Goalsfather” for his extraordinary ability to consistently outwit goalkeepers and find the back of the net.

Rashidi Yekini passed away in 2012, but his indelible legacy continues to inspire a new generation of football enthusiasts, demonstrating that remarkable feats can be achieved regardless of one’s humble beginnings. His story is a testament to the resilience of the human spirit and the enduring power of sport to uplift and unite people worldwide.

As Google pays tribute to this football legend, the world is reminded of the impact of individuals like Rashidi Yekini, who transcended adversity to etch their names in the annals of history through their unparalleled achievements in the beautiful game.
